当前位置: 首页 > news >正文

网站建设 英语毛戈平化妆培训学校官网

网站建设 英语,毛戈平化妆培训学校官网,网站内容如何优化,做论坛网站时应该注意什么Vue 3 是一款用于构建用户界面的 JavaScript 框架。 在 Vue 3 中,SFC(Single File Component)的 API 风格发生了变化,新增了 setup 函数而废弃了之前版本的 options API。setup 函数被认为是 Vue 3 的精华所在,它可以让…

Vue 3 是一款用于构建用户界面的 JavaScript 框架。 在 Vue 3 中,SFC(Single File Component)的 API 风格发生了变化,新增了 setup 函数而废弃了之前版本的 options API。setup 函数被认为是 Vue 3 的精华所在,它可以让开发者更好地组织代码和实现高级功能。然而,由于 setup 函数的特殊性质,使用 Vue 2 中的 this 获取属性和方法会有所不同。本文将探讨如何在 Vue 3 中使用 setup 函数获取类似于 Vue 2 中的 this。

什么是 setup 函数

Vue 3 中的 setup 函数是一种新机制,它被视为一个重要特征。 setup 函数代替了 Vue 2.x 中的 created、mounted 等选项。它是一个接收两个参数的函数:props 和 context,并返回一个渲染上下文。

setup(props,context){ // ... return {renderContext} }

在这个函数中,我们可以做一些初始化工作,例如:创建响应式数据、引入复杂的逻辑代码等。setup 函数没有 this 上下文,因此无法使用 this 关键字来引用组件实例上的属性和方法。

如何获取 Vue 2 中的 this

在 Vue 2 中,我们可以在 methods 和 computed 等属性的函数中使用 this 关键字,以便引用组件中的属性和方法,例如:

export default { data() { return { count: 0, }; }, methods: { increment() { this.count++; }, }, };

然而,在 Vue 3 中,由于 setup 函数没有 this 上下文,我们无法引用 Vue 组件中的实例属性和方法。因此,你需要用不同的方式来获取它们。

使用 ref 获取数据

在 Vue 3 中,数据被定义为响应式。 setup 函数可以使用 ref 来创建一个响应式变量,并使用 value 属性访问其值,例如:

import { ref } from "vue"; export default { setup(props,context){ const count = ref(0); const increment = () => { count.value++; }; return { count, increment, }; }, };

在这个示例中,我们使用 ref 创建了一个可响应的变量 count,并且在 increment 函数中使用了 count.value 来递增计数器。

使用 reactive 获取对象

如果你需要在 Vue 3 中创建一个响应式对象,可以使用 reactive 函数。reactive 函数会将一个对象转换为响应式对象,使其属性可以被追踪和更新。

import { reactive } from "vue"; export default { setup(props,context){ const state = reactive({ count: 0, }); const increment = () => { state.count++; }; return { state, increment, }; }, };

在这个示例中,我们使用 reactive 将一个对象 state 转换为响应式对象。在 increment 函数中,我们可以像访问普通属性那样访问 state.count 属性。

结论

在 Vue 3 中,setup 函数取代了 Vue 2.x 中的 created 和 mounted 函数,并提供了一种新的方式来组织代码和实现高级功能。由于 setup 函数没有 this 上下文,我们需要使用 ref 和 reactive 来获取组件实例的属性和方法。通过这种方式,我们可以简化我们的代码、使其更具可读性和易于维护。


文章转载自:
http://dinncoturbellarian.ydfr.cn
http://dinnconorman.ydfr.cn
http://dinncooland.ydfr.cn
http://dinncotaig.ydfr.cn
http://dinncoyttriferous.ydfr.cn
http://dinncosuburbia.ydfr.cn
http://dinnconematocide.ydfr.cn
http://dinncopavonine.ydfr.cn
http://dinncoshandrydan.ydfr.cn
http://dinncothoracopagus.ydfr.cn
http://dinncogoddamn.ydfr.cn
http://dinncoedentate.ydfr.cn
http://dinncounreadable.ydfr.cn
http://dinncomisdata.ydfr.cn
http://dinncomagnetofluiddynamic.ydfr.cn
http://dinncodacquoise.ydfr.cn
http://dinncosilty.ydfr.cn
http://dinncoimpregnant.ydfr.cn
http://dinncozelkova.ydfr.cn
http://dinncomacrobiosis.ydfr.cn
http://dinncotarheel.ydfr.cn
http://dinncouncustomed.ydfr.cn
http://dinncoplurality.ydfr.cn
http://dinncointerjacency.ydfr.cn
http://dinncocriminology.ydfr.cn
http://dinncochemiloon.ydfr.cn
http://dinncobioelectric.ydfr.cn
http://dinncopulley.ydfr.cn
http://dinncofosse.ydfr.cn
http://dinncopalingenetic.ydfr.cn
http://dinncooakmoss.ydfr.cn
http://dinncocia.ydfr.cn
http://dinncoaerie.ydfr.cn
http://dinncobuckler.ydfr.cn
http://dinncoconspiratress.ydfr.cn
http://dinncorejuvenescence.ydfr.cn
http://dinncopropitiator.ydfr.cn
http://dinncoequanimously.ydfr.cn
http://dinncoorganosilicon.ydfr.cn
http://dinncojohnston.ydfr.cn
http://dinncoinveracious.ydfr.cn
http://dinncopicayunish.ydfr.cn
http://dinncoafterbrain.ydfr.cn
http://dinncojudiciary.ydfr.cn
http://dinncofinsteraarhorn.ydfr.cn
http://dinncotractility.ydfr.cn
http://dinncoconjunct.ydfr.cn
http://dinncopictish.ydfr.cn
http://dinncoyeomanry.ydfr.cn
http://dinncogadgetry.ydfr.cn
http://dinncoelisabeth.ydfr.cn
http://dinncobiomere.ydfr.cn
http://dinncolar.ydfr.cn
http://dinncoactinotheraphy.ydfr.cn
http://dinncothereafter.ydfr.cn
http://dinncoresignation.ydfr.cn
http://dinncowendic.ydfr.cn
http://dinncodermatoplasty.ydfr.cn
http://dinncofling.ydfr.cn
http://dinncosilent.ydfr.cn
http://dinncoshrike.ydfr.cn
http://dinncodecolour.ydfr.cn
http://dinncolak.ydfr.cn
http://dinncosentimentalism.ydfr.cn
http://dinncounutterably.ydfr.cn
http://dinncodegeneracy.ydfr.cn
http://dinncometrist.ydfr.cn
http://dinncodryly.ydfr.cn
http://dinncocongelation.ydfr.cn
http://dinncosemirigid.ydfr.cn
http://dinncolaevogyrate.ydfr.cn
http://dinncorefractor.ydfr.cn
http://dinncofibrid.ydfr.cn
http://dinncomonasticism.ydfr.cn
http://dinnconitrotrichloromethane.ydfr.cn
http://dinncomasticator.ydfr.cn
http://dinncoequitation.ydfr.cn
http://dinnconegrophobia.ydfr.cn
http://dinncopollock.ydfr.cn
http://dinncoexorbitance.ydfr.cn
http://dinncogravicembalo.ydfr.cn
http://dinncomammon.ydfr.cn
http://dinncodragline.ydfr.cn
http://dinncotephrite.ydfr.cn
http://dinncosollicker.ydfr.cn
http://dinncochalaza.ydfr.cn
http://dinncobalaton.ydfr.cn
http://dinncoaerobic.ydfr.cn
http://dinncorife.ydfr.cn
http://dinncosemester.ydfr.cn
http://dinncooutlive.ydfr.cn
http://dinncoeater.ydfr.cn
http://dinncotelemark.ydfr.cn
http://dinncodecani.ydfr.cn
http://dinncoknockabout.ydfr.cn
http://dinncotautomerize.ydfr.cn
http://dinncometre.ydfr.cn
http://dinncoisopropyl.ydfr.cn
http://dinncoinundatory.ydfr.cn
http://dinncomrs.ydfr.cn
http://www.dinnco.com/news/154328.html

相关文章:

  • 网站为什么做版心限制seo自学网app
  • 网站备案局快速刷排名seo软件
  • 山东建设科技产品推广网站网站制作工具
  • 海口快速建站公司推荐网络营销策划方案模板
  • 网站建设空间步骤详解网址大全导航
  • 湖北营销型网站建设多少钱广州市新闻最新消息
  • wordpress回帖可见seo优化网站推广专员招聘
  • 200平别墅装修25万效果关键词优化快排
  • 做招聘网站代理商需要多少钱企业网站制作费用
  • 海门网站制作优化大师apk
  • 邯郸网站设计有哪些公司网站开发费用
  • 建设企业官方网站的流程淘宝新店怎么快速做起来
  • 做平面设计在什么网站能挣钱网络优化工作应该怎么做
  • h5做网站什么软件抖音关键词查询工具
  • 网站数据库问题seo网站优化工具
  • 医药公司网站建设方案seo免费软件
  • 自己的主机做服务器网站如何备案上海关键词排名优化怎样
  • 网站建设服务费百度快速排名用什
  • 专门做软陶的网站百度总部在哪里
  • 系统优化的约束条件关键词优化是怎么弄的
  • 企业管理系统项目简介怎么写好搜索引擎优化管理实验报告
  • 遵义新闻头条同仁seo排名优化培训
  • 如何做网站更新外贸接单十大网站
  • 广州专业网站优化公司软文推广发布
  • 电子商务网站建设报告怎么写沈阳seo网站推广
  • 公司网络维护服务方案网站怎么优化seo
  • 本网站服务器设在美国服务器保护怎么自己制作网页
  • 团队网站建设百度流量推广项目
  • 医馆网站建设方案搜外网友情链接
  • 盘锦网站建设公司快速网站搭建